 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Conserving Ecosystems by Ceasing the Importation of Large Animal Trophies Act or the CECIL Act

This bill restricts: (1) the importation or exportation of species that have been proposed to be listed as threatened or endangered species, or (2) the importation of sport-hunted trophy of a threatened species or endangered species. In addition, the bill abolishes the International Wildlife Conservation Council of the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service.
